入选标准
- •Men between ages of 50 and 75
排除标准
- •1. Previous PSA test or prostate cancer
- •2. Inability to access internet
- •3. Men who are known to be unable to read English
- •4. Serious uncontrolled medical conditions or concurrent medical illness likely to compromise life expectancy
- •5. Severe mental illness or dementia
